  • Abstract
    Solve the problem of the steady transition in CNC machine speed in the high speed machining during start and stop. Based on the linear interpolation algorithm of double-axis and two dimensional, a new control method for double-axis stepper motor accelerating and decelerating at the same time was put forward, and the hardware on FPGA was realized. By two stepper motors directed to X and Y controlled through a set of circular distributor and driving-circuit, a transition may be steady. The simulation result gave good control effect and showed the effectiveness of this algorithm.
